What is a “tummy tuck” procedure (abdominoplasty)?

A Tummy Tuck (abdominoplasty) is a procedure which involves removal of extra fat, skin and tightening of the abdominal muscles in your abdominal wall. This surgical procedure can also involve repositioning or creating a new belly button opening on the abdominal skin. This means up to 4 anatomical areas are addressed on the abdomen with only 1 procedure, leading to significant changes and transformations for patients.

There are multiple types of Tummy tucks. Starting with:

  • A Mini tuck, which involves addressing a small portion of the lower abdomen skin/fat with or without need for repairing the lower abdominal muscles.
  • The maximum extent of correction of the abdomen involves an “extended abdominoplasty” or “Maxi tuck” which involves an incision from hip/hip region which will involve removal of the entire lower abdomen/fat tissue along with total repair of upper and lower abdominal muscles. Here the umbilicus (belly button) will also be repositioned.

What should I expect from a “tummy tuck” scar?

At Modern Surgical Arts of Denver, we take the potential scaring very seriously as a board-certified cosmetic surgeon, Drs. Dastoury or Zwiebel will identify and place the desired incision as low as possible. We want patients to have the option of wearing a bathing suit without having to be self-conscious about their abdominoplasty scar. Drs. Dastoury or Zwiebel also utilizes a combination of silicone cream and silicone sheets for up to 1 year during the healing process. Silicone has been shown to help with scar maturation, redness, and help create flat scars. Additionally, at Modern Surgical Arts of Denver we offer laser treatments for scars treatment at 3-6 months. Lastly, if scars are widened Drs. Dastoury or Zwiebel may offer to perform a scar revision for ideal healing and results after the 3-month healing period.

Does Belly Fat Come Back After Tummy Tuck Surgery?

A tummy tuck is one of the most popular forms of cosmetic body surgery because it addresses a common problem: the abdomen. Even with diet and exercise, many people cannot lose the roundness and bloated appearance typical of the tummy area. A tummy tuck removes the stubborn remaining fat, tightens the skin, and improves the appearance of the abdominal muscles. But do the results last?

Weight Distribution and Your Tummy Tuck

Following a tummy tuck, your abdominal area will be flatter because your surgeon has removed excess fat and skin. However, the procedure is localized, so any weight loss will only be in the surgical region. Your hips, buttocks, and other areas remain unchanged.

In the area of your tummy tuck, fat cells are removed. Those cells are gone forever and cannot return. If your weight fluctuates by 10 to 15 pounds after a tummy tuck, the weight will be gained in other areas where you have more fat cells.

While you may still have some fat cells in the abdominal area, there are not as many, and you will not grow new fat cells. However, if you gain excessive weight, the remaining cells may grow larger. Following a tummy tuck, these larger fat cells are not as much of a problem because the surgery has joined the abdominal muscles on either side for a firmer, leaner appearance that holds the fat in place beneath the muscle.

Realistic Expectations

Remember that a tummy tuck is a contouring procedure, not a weight loss procedure. While you may lose a few pounds when the excess fat and skin are removed, this is not about losing lots of excess weight. The surgery targets small areas of stubborn belly fat and sagging or loose skin for a tighter, more fit appearance. Be aware that significant weight gain or pregnancy will stretch out the muscles and can negatively impact the success of your tummy tuck.

What You Can Do to Maintain Your Tummy Tuck

The flat stomach you are rewarded with following a tummy tuck can last indefinitely if your weight stays within a range of 15 pounds above or below your surgery weight. Because the muscles have been surgically placed for optimal effectiveness, you will continue to see a flatter stomach even years after surgery unless you gain a lot of weight.

The best way to ensure lasting results is to maintain your body weight and exercise regularly to keep the abdominal walls strong. This prevents stretching of the skin and muscles, helping you keep your sleek new look. Be aware of any triggers contributing to weight gain, including stress, hormone shifts, and lack of sleep. While your weight will change as you age, a good exercise and healthy eating plan can help you maintain your tummy tuck for years.
